Hi Martijn,

On Oct 22, 2009, at 9:47 AM, Martijn van Steenbergen wrote:

I've heard fixed-point view, open datatypes and some others, but I'm curious where this pattern comes up in literature and what it is called there.

Tim Sheard and Emir Pasalic call this technique "two-level types" in their JFP'04 paper Two-Level Types and Parameterized Modules:

    http://homepage.mac.com/pasalic/p2/papers/JfpPearl.pdf

Cheers,
Sebastian


--
Underestimating the novelty of the future is a time-honored tradition.
(D.G.)



_______________________________________________
Haskell-Cafe mailing list
Haskell-Cafe@haskell.org
http://www.haskell.org/mailman/listinfo/haskell-cafe

Reply via email to